Admission Requirements
Before applying to the Strategic Communication master’s degree, you must meet the following requirements:
- A completed undergraduate degree from an accredited institution in:
- Advertising
- Communication Studies
- Marketing
- Mass Communication
- Public Relations
- Other subject areas (e.g., Business, English, History, Political Science, Psychology)
- Cumulative undergraduate GPA of 3.0 on a 4.0 scale
- Access to a laptop or desktop computer and reliable internet connection
We recommend applicants also have professional work or internship experience in advertising, marketing, public relations, or related fields.
If you do not have either coursework or career experience in communications, we may ask you to complete pre-requisite classes prior to starting the program to ensure your success.
Provisional Admission
If you do not meet the program GPA requirement but have a GPA of at least 2.6, you may be admitted on a provisional basis.
You may explain the circumstances that may have affected your GPA in your personal statement.
Students who have been admitted on a provisional basis must achieve at least a 3.0 GPA after their first 12 credits of Strategic Communication coursework.
Apply to the Strategic Communication Graduate Program
Once you are accepted into Graduate Studies, you must then apply to the Strategic Communication graduate program.
Application deadlines are:
- Summer session: April 15
- Fall term: July 15
- Spring term: Nov. 15
Within your online application, you’ll include the following items:
- Current resumé
- A written personal statement, no more than 2 pages in length, that:
- introduces yourself to the selection committee
- explains how your academic and career experiences shaped your desire for this graduate degree
- describes your post-graduation career goals and/or plans
- Contact information for 2 references from a current or former employer or professor
